A PIN diode is made of an I-type region separated by the P-type and N-type regions. Forward-biasing the diode adjusts the resistivity of the I-type region. Diodes take in power through an anode and release it into a positively-charged area of a semiconductor.
High breakdown voltage and low junction capacitance are the major drivers which help in surging the growth of PIN diode market whereas the temperature limit specified by the manufactures should not exceed which act as a restraining factor for this market.
